Senator Blunt on VA Secretary Shinseki’s Resignation

WASHINGTON, D.C. – U.S. Senator Roy Blunt (Mo.) released the following statement today regarding U.S. Secretary of Veterans Affairs (VA) Eric Shinseki’s resignation amid the VA scandal:

“I’ve long said these serious and systemic problems at the VA were never about one individual – and it will not be fixed until the president steps forward to take action and fix this failure on behalf of Americas’ heroes. President Obama must show leadership and give our veterans the care they deserve.”

This week, Blunt visited the John Cochran VA Hospital in St. Louis, Mo. and the Harry S. Truman Memorial Veterans’ Hospital in Columbia, Mo. to meet with officials and discuss mental health care at the VA. On May 12, 2014, Blunt joined U.S. Senator Claire McCaskill (Mo.) in sending a letter to the VA Secretary and the VA St. Louis Health Care System demanding answers regarding serious allegations of delays and inefficiencies at the John Cochran VA in St. Louis, Mo.
